Virat Kohli is on the verge of breaking another Master Blaster’s record in upcoming Test Series against Australia

The Indian National Cricket Team enter the Test series against Australia. Before the four-match test series that will start from December 6, Cricket Australia XI vs India, a 4-day Practice Match at Sydney Cricket Ground has been scheduled from November 28.

Team India has a better balance in the batting order. Different roles are assigned to different batsmen but Virat Kohli who is considered as the best batsman in the world is a major support for Team India.
The Indian captain Virat Kohli has been in amazing form this year in Test matches. He has
scored centuries in South Africa and England. He has always been a run-getter on Australian pitches.
The first test of the four-match test series is in Adelaide on December 6 where Virat Kohli is on the verge of breaking another Master Blaster’s record. He might overtake master blaster Sachin Tendulkar record for the most number of centuries scored in Australia.
Sachin Tendulkar is at the top of the list of most Test centuries against Australia in Australia with 6 centuries in 20 matches. Following Sachin is Sunil Gavaskar with 5 centuries in 11 matches and Virat Kohli with 5 centuries in 8 matches. VVS Laxman holds 4 centuries in 15 matches while Mohinder Amarnath has 2 centuries in 8 matches in Australia.
Virat Kohli has five centuries to his name in Australian soil and is just one century short of Sachin’s tally. In the previous tour, Virat Kohli scored four centuries in the series and as he is the better form can past Sachin’s record.
Sachin Tendulkar has scored 1809 runs in 20 Tests at an average of 53.20 while Virat Kohli has scored 992 runs in 8 matches against Australia an average of 62. The task will not be easy for Kohli as Australia have good bowlers like Mitchell Starc, Pat Cummins, and Josh Hazlewood.
